emlix designt, integriert, dokumentiert und testet Update-fähige Container-Konzepte auf Basis der OpenContainerInitiative (OCI) und vergleichbarer Standards. Industrieunternehmen profitieren von beschleunigten Entwicklungs-, Test- und Produktionszyklen.
Container umfassen die Applikation sowie ein Dateisystem, das alles beinhaltet, was die Anwendung für Ihre Ausführung benötigt. Sie können nur über wenige definierte Schnittstellen kommunizieren. Dieses erlaubt eine einfache Migration von einem Linux-System zum nächsten. Container-Technologien vereinfachen zudem das Testen von verteilten Systemkomponenten.
Professionell Portieren und Warten durch Application Container
Containervirtualisierungen bilden eine Umgebung für Applikationen, die auf einem System isoliert voneinander laufen. Anders als bei einer Voll-Virtualisierung besitzt ein Container kein eigenes Betriebssystem. Es wird jedoch eine Unabhängigkeit von dem darunter liegenden Linux System und seiner Hardwareplattform erreicht.
Unser Portfolio umfasst:
- Analyse von Anforderungen für den Einsatz von Containern
- Design Container-basierter Architekturen
- Container-basierte Systeme mit runc, LXC und rkt
- Zusammenstellen und Integration von Containern
- Container Build- und Testinfrastruktur (DevOps)
- Warten von Container-basierten Systemen
Auf ein schwergewichtiges Framework wie Docker wird dabei häufig verzichtet, der Funktionsumfang aber in ähnlicher Weise erreicht.
Vorteile für Sicherheitskritische Anwendungen
Auf Basis von runc, LXC und rkt kommen Container-basierte Architekturen von emlix in unterschiedlichsten Branchen und Anwendungsfeldern zum Einsatz. Durch das Zusammenspiel über verschiedene Container in einem Produkt orchestrieren wir beispielsweise eine sicherheitskritische Anwendung, eine multimediale GUI-Applikation, eine Java Middleware sowie Web-Server, Cloud-Konnektoren und Third Party Software in separat wartbaren Containern eines Linux Board Support Packages.